Posts: 0</TD><TD></TD></TR></TABLE> Re: Ok, new trivia Because of the same reason why Germanic runes (Futhark) and the Latin letters are linear, and for example, the Arabian letters fluid: the first were mainly carved in stone, for which purpose linear letters are more appropriate because more force can be put behind a line than a bow. And writing, like the Arabs, with ink on paper or leather, is easier with fluid letters (try writing Futharks per hand and you know what I mean...). </p> |
